Software eng dies on b’day in front of dad at Chennai Airport

CHENNAI: In a tragic incident, a 30-year-old software engineer, who arrived from Australia enroute Singapore, died of massive heart attack at the Anna International Airport here in the early hours of today even as his father, who came to greet him on his birthday, watched his son swooning at the visitor’s lounge. Vishnu (30), a native of Thennoor in Tiruchirapalli District, was waiting to collect his baggage after completing immigration and customs formalities, when he suddenly swooned with blood oozing out from his mouth, right in front of his father who was waiting at the visitor’s lounge, airport sources said. Though taken aback with the sudden development, a medical team examined and declared he died of sudden massive heart attack. His father Ilangovan, an Industrialist, who arrived from Tiruchirapalli to take home the ‘birthday boy,’ stood in disbelief as Doctors and Airport authorities failed to fi nd words to console him. The sad part of the incident was Vishnu, who turned 30yesterday, had asked his father to come down to the Airport stating he wanted get birthday wishes from him before the stroke of midnight, on his arrival. However, he could not get his ‘last’ wishes fulfi lled as the Singapore Airlines fl ight, which was scheduled to land at 2200 hrs last night, aborted its landing and fl ew to Bangalore as a Cargo fl ight got stuck at the runway. Expecting to meet his son at 2200 hrs, Ilangovan came to the visitor’s lounge around 2130 hrs but learnt the fl ight had been diverted to Bangalore as the Chennai- Russia Cargo Flight got stranded on the runway. As the Singapore Airlines fl ight belonged to the Airbus class and required full runway for landing, it was diverted to Bangalore after being made to hover around the city for about 30 minutes.
